What Are the Most Popular Esports Games for Betting?
The most popular esports games for betting include titles like League of Legends, Dota 2, Counter-Strike: Global Offensive (CS:GO), and Overwatch. These games have a large player base, competitive scenes, and frequent tournaments, making them attractive options for esports betting.
Among bettors, League of Legends is particularly popular due to its strategic gameplay and international tournaments such as the World Championships. Additionally, CS:GO, with its fast-paced action and intense matches, also draws a significant amount of betting activity. Other top choices for esports betting include Dota 2 and Overwatch, which have dedicated fan bases and prestigious tournaments.

Similarities between Esports and Traditional Sports Betting
When comparing esports and traditional sports betting, there are several similarities that both types of betting share:
1. Betting Options | Both esports and traditional sports offer a variety of betting options, including predicting match winners, tournament outcomes, and individual player performances. |
2. Odds and Betting Markets | Similar to traditional sports, esports betting also provides odds and various betting markets, such as handicaps, over/under, and prop bets. |
3. Live Betting | Both esports and traditional sports betting allow for live betting, where bettors can place wagers during the course of a match or game. |
4. Entertainment and Engagement | Both forms of betting offer entertainment and engagement for fans, with the excitement of watching matches and the potential to win bets. |

2. Innovative Betting Options
Esports betting offers a variety of creative and unique betting options that attract a new generation of bettors. These options include:
- Live betting, where wagers can be placed during a match, providing an interactive and dynamic experience.
- Innovative prop bets, allowing bettors to wager on specific in-game events, such as the first team to destroy a tower or the player with the most kills.
- Virtual currency betting, giving users the opportunity to practice their betting strategies without risking real money.
These cutting-edge options enhance the excitement and engagement for bettors in the rapidly growing esports market.

2. Cultural Differences and Regional Preferences
Cultural differences and regional preferences play a crucial role in the success of esports betting brands. Understanding and catering to these differences can help brands attract a wider audience and tailor their offerings to specific markets. Here are some key factors to keep in mind:
- Game Preferences: Different regions have varying preferences for esports games. For example, League of Legends is popular in Asia, while Counter-Strike: Global Offensive has a strong following in Europe. Brands should focus on games that resonate with their target markets.
- Betting Habits: Cultural norms and regulations around gambling can differ greatly. Some regions have a strong tradition of sports betting, while others may have restrictions or different attitudes towards gambling. Brands must adapt their strategies accordingly.
- Localization: Offering localized content, customer support, and payment options can enhance the user experience and build trust with players from different cultures. Brands should invest in market research and localization efforts to cater to regional preferences.
By acknowledging cultural differences and adapting to regional preferences, esports betting brands can expand their reach and establish a strong presence in various markets.
3. Integrity and Fairness Concerns
Integrity and fairness are major concerns within the realm of esports betting. To address these concerns, online sports betting brands should take the following steps:
- Establish strict regulations and guidelines to ensure fair competition and prevent any form of cheating.
- Implement robust verification processes to confirm the identities of players and prevent any instances of match-fixing.
- Invest in advanced technology and data analysis to detect any suspicious betting patterns or irregularities.
- Educate and train their staff and customers about the importance of integrity and fair play in esports betting.
- Collaborate with esports organizations, game publishers, and gambling regulators to establish industry-wide standards and best practices.
By taking these steps, online sports betting brands can contribute to maintaining the integrity and fairness of the esports betting market, ultimately creating a more trustworthy and enjoyable experience for all involved.
